Beyond the Label

We’ve been singing the praises of Portuguese wines for years. Why?

Because this sunny, hot and historic wine country (even though it’s best-known for lusciously sweet Port wines) is a wellspring of rich, dry reds that are LONG on flavor and short on price. And when they’re crafted at a hugely acclaimed estate like Casa Santos Lima—named one of the world’s Top 100 Wineries by the World Ranking of Wine & Spirits—you really can’t go wrong.

Amoras hails from their sustainably farmed Lisboa vineyards, which are blessed with cooling coastal breezes and long hours of sunshine. A thicket of blackberry bushes—called amoras—also thrives here, along the perimeter of the vineyards. They help keep hungry birds interested in snacks other than the grapes.

Last vintage, Amoras won a BIG trophy at a top Portuguese competition, and this new release earned a ‘Best Buy’ rating from Wine Enthusiast. Deep ruby-red in color, it offers up loads of ripe black cherry and baking spice aromas. Red fruits follow on the palate (cherry, raspberry), alongside toasted vanilla from 4 months’ aging in oak barriques. The long finish is savory and smooth. This red is the perfect partner for roasted red meats or barbecued chicken.
